// Heads up: this client replaces the old Mudlark ORM session factory.
// We're mid-refactor, so some legacy models still route through the shim —
// if support sees duplicate-row tickets, that's probably why.
// The new client talks straight to the Copperline data service instead of
// the ORM pool. It authenticates with the key below.

gateway credential: kto23_LX9A4ys6i4nzHtpOLNLodKK

## Support

Snapshot tests for the Lumara UI kit live under `tests/snapshots` and run on every merge to main. If a customer reports a rendering regression, first check whether the corresponding snapshot was updated in the last release, as stale baselines are the most common cause. Do not regenerate snapshots yourself; the Pellwick team owns that pipeline. For triage help or baseline questions, reach the maintainers here.

escalation mailbox, yafog-kafof: eliok@xolmarcloud.local

For the board: the Torvane market entry has completed its diligence phase. Regulatory counsel confirms no material barriers; local distribution talks with Ferncroft Trading are advanced but unsigned. Capital requirement is estimated at the midpoint of the range presented in May, with first revenue expected within three quarters of launch. Staffing would begin with a twelve-person hub in Elsmere. Risks and mitigations are detailed in the annex. The confidential note on forward plans appears directly below.

board note of kadup-kageg: Ralaelek Systems is in early talks to buy Kasdorax Logistics for about $187.4 million. The Tamvan launch date is December 22, and nothing goes to the press before then. Legal wants the Gilaelix Works term sheet countersigned before November 3.

Title: Scheduler double-waters bed 3 after DST shift

New folks: the Verdella scheduler stores watering slots in local time. After the clock change, slot 06:00 fires twice, soaking the herb bed. Fix: store UTC, convert at display. Repro on the Oakhollow test rig only. To reproduce, install the firmware identified by the token below.

build token for hafop-kahog: htk31_a432ac515d5bb1362002c1e1a7e80ef